Prime Location in Harbord Village! A rare opportunity to own a legal duplex in one of Torontos most desirable neighbourhoodsjust steps to U of T, Bloor Street, Spadina, TTC, and a wide array of restaurants and amenities. This spacious property features 13 rooms, two kitchens, and a finished basement with two large bedrooms, three bathrooms and two separate entrances, offering strong rental potential with current income of up to $10,000/month. This home presents a fantastic opportunity for investors or end-users to add their personal touch and significantly increase value. Excellent potential to build a laneway house for additional income. A solid investment in a high-demand area with endless possibilities!

Who lives here?

South Annex,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, university grads, executives and science, education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of youth aged 20 to 24 and adults aged 25 to 39.
